Recollective Awareness Meditation is a flexible, gentle approach to Buddhist meditation that offers an authentic way to investigate your inner world. By exploring your meditation experiences, you naturally cultivate awareness and beneficial states of consciousness.
At this retreat there will be periods of sitting meditation, silent reflection, and group discussion. New perspectives are discovered in small group and individual interviews facilitated by the teacher. Beginning and experienced meditators are welcome.
Nelly Kaufer serves as the resident teacher for the Skillful Meditation Project in Portland. Because she has witnessed a more intimate understanding of Buddhist dharma and a kinder regard for the variety of meditative experiences, she is dedicated to Recollective Awareness Meditation. In addition to teaching meditation for the last 28 years, she is a psychotherapist with a longstanding practice.

The teachers in this tradition do not charge a fee for their work, they offer the teachings freely and generously. They rely on students’ donations or “dana” as the sole support for their teaching activities. Your generosity is greatly appreciated.
